Interface PaymentConfiguration.Builder
- All Superinterfaces:
Buildable,CopyableBuilder<PaymentConfiguration.Builder,,PaymentConfiguration> SdkBuilder<PaymentConfiguration.Builder,,PaymentConfiguration> SdkPojo
- Enclosing class:
PaymentConfiguration
public static interface PaymentConfiguration.Builder
extends SdkPojo, CopyableBuilder<PaymentConfiguration.Builder,PaymentConfiguration>
-
Method Summary
Modifier and TypeMethodDescriptiondefault PaymentConfiguration.BuilderqueryCompute(Consumer<QueryComputePaymentConfig.Builder> queryCompute) The collaboration member's payment responsibilities set by the collaboration creator for query compute costs.queryCompute(QueryComputePaymentConfig queryCompute) The collaboration member's payment responsibilities set by the collaboration creator for query compute costs.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copyMethods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, buildMethods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
-
Method Details
-
queryCompute
The collaboration member's payment responsibilities set by the collaboration creator for query compute costs.
- Parameters:
queryCompute- The collaboration member's payment responsibilities set by the collaboration creator for query compute costs.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
queryCompute
default PaymentConfiguration.Builder queryCompute(Consumer<QueryComputePaymentConfig.Builder> queryCompute) The collaboration member's payment responsibilities set by the collaboration creator for query compute costs.
This is a convenience method that creates an instance of theQueryComputePaymentConfig.Builderavoiding the need to create one manually viaQueryComputePaymentConfig.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ed toqueryCompute(QueryComputePaymentConfig).- Parameters:
queryCompute- a consumer that will call methods onQueryComputePaymentConfig.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-